Common Mistakes to Avoid
Even with a solid dentist email database, your outreach can flop if you fall into these common traps. Avoid them to save time, protect your brand, and get better results.
Poor Quality Data or Targeting
- Sending to out-of-date or irrelevant contacts leads to high bounce rates and spam complaints
- If your data hasn’t been cleaned or segmented, your message won’t land with the right person
- Always start with a clean, accurate, and well-structured list
Overly Technical or Vague Messaging
- Dentists aren’t techies—they want clear, benefit-led messaging
- Avoid jargon or generic lines like “We’re a full-service provider”
- Focus on practical results (e.g. saves 2 hours per day, reduces no-shows, improves cash flow)
Ignoring GDPR Compliance
- Sending bulk emails without identifying your business or offering opt-outs risks non-compliance
- Even in B2B, GDPR rules apply—get this wrong and you’ll damage trust or worse
- GDPR compliance is not optional—it’s essential for long-term credibility
Avoid these pitfalls, and your campaigns will instantly perform better.
Preparing Your Dentist Data for Outreach
Before you hit “send,” your dentist email database needs a bit of prep work. Clean, segmented data helps you tailor your approach and increases the chances of a response.
Clean and Segment the Database
- Remove any duplicates or outdated contacts
- Standardise formatting for easy importing into email platforms or CRMs
- Segment based on factors like:
- Region or postcode
- Practice type (NHS, private, mixed)
- Size (solo vs. multi-surgery)
Prioritise Decision-Makers
- Focus your emails on people who can act—usually the practice owner, lead dentist, or practice manager
- Avoid general inboxes (like reception@) if personalised outreach is your goal
Remove Duplicates and Invalid Contacts
- Check for syntax errors, old domains, or typos
- High-quality data improves your sender reputation and ensures better inbox placement
- Consider scheduling regular database hygiene if you’re using the data across multiple campaigns
Solid prep means smoother outreach—and far better returns.
Writing Effective Campaigns for Dentists
Having a strong dentist email database is only half the battle. The next step is writing outreach that gets opened, read, and acted on by busy dental professionals.
Keep It Practical and Patient-Oriented
- Focus your message on how your product or service improves patient care or practice efficiency
- Dentists care about tools that save time, reduce admin, or improve treatment outcomes
- Examples:
- “Cut your admin time by 30% with automated reminders”
- “Help patients book faster with our easy scheduling tool”
Use Trust-Building Language
- Demonstrate industry knowledge and professionalism
- Mention your experience working with similar practices or regions
- Keep the tone friendly but direct—don’t oversell or sound desperate
End with a Clear Call to Action
- Avoid vague phrases like “let us know” or “get in touch”
- Use specific, low-friction CTAs like:
- “Book a free 10-minute intro call”
- “Request a tailored quote”
- “See how it works in 2 clicks”
Great emails feel relevant and respectful. Keep it short, focused, and action-oriented.
Stay GDPR-Compliant
When using a dentist email database for outreach, compliance with the GDPR is crucial—not just to avoid fines, but to show that your business is professional and trustworthy.
What GDPR Means for B2B Email Marketing
Under GDPR, B2B marketing is allowed under “legitimate interest” if you:
- Clearly identify your business in every message
- Offer a simple opt-out option
- Make sure your message is relevant to the recipient’s role or business
This allows you to contact dental practices with business-relevant offers—but you must do so transparently.
CTPS Screening for Phone Numbers
If you plan to follow up by phone, you must screen numbers against the Corporate Telephone Preference Service (CTPS). This protects practices that have opted out of unsolicited calls.
Build Trust Through Ethical Outreach
- Use accurate subject lines and sender names
- Include your company address and contact info
- Respect opt-outs immediately
When your outreach feels safe and respectful, dentists are far more likely to engage.
